当前位置: 首页 > news >正文

IC-Light:重新定义图像光照艺术的智能革命

IC-Light:重新定义图像光照艺术的智能革命

【免费下载链接】IC-LightMore relighting!项目地址: https://gitcode.com/GitHub_Trending/ic/IC-Light

IC-Light是一款基于人工智能的图像光照处理工具,它通过"Imposing Consistent Light"技术重新定义了图像光照艺术。这款开源项目能够让用户轻松实现文本条件或背景条件下的图像重新打光,为摄影后期、设计创作等领域带来前所未有的可能性。

🌟 IC-Light的核心功能与优势

IC-Light提供了两种强大的光照处理模型,让普通用户也能轻松创作出专业级的光影效果:

🔹 文本条件光照模型

只需输入简单的文本描述,IC-Light就能根据你的想象调整图像光照效果。例如"sunshine from window"(窗边阳光)、"neon light, city"(城市霓虹)或"sunset over sea"(海上日落)等描述,都能精准转化为对应的光影效果。

IC-Light文本条件光照效果展示,通过简单文字描述即可实现专业级光影调整

🔹 背景条件光照模型

当你需要将前景主体融入新的背景环境时,背景条件光照模型会自动分析背景光照特点,让主体与新环境的光影完美融合,实现无缝合成。

IC-Light背景条件光照模型可实现主体与背景的自然光影融合

🚀 快速开始:5分钟上手IC-Light

一键安装步骤

IC-Light的安装过程非常简单,只需执行以下命令:

git clone https://gitcode.com/GitHub_Trending/ic/IC-Light cd IC-Light conda create -n iclight python=3.10 conda activate iclight pip install torch torchvision --index-url https://download.pytorch.org/whl/cu121 pip install -r requirements.txt

最快启动方法

安装完成后,你可以通过以下命令启动不同功能的演示界面:

  • 文本条件光照模型:python gradio_demo.py
  • 背景条件光照模型:python gradio_demo_bg.py

模型会在首次运行时自动下载,无需额外配置。

💡 实用技巧:解锁IC-Light全部潜力

最佳提示词(Prompt)编写指南

IC-Light的效果很大程度上取决于提示词的质量。以下是一些经过验证的优质提示词组合:

  • "beautiful woman, detailed face, warm atmosphere, at home, bedroom"(温馨卧室氛围)
  • "handsome man, detailed face, neon light, city"(城市霓虹灯下的男性)
  • "portrait, soft studio lighting, professional photography"(专业工作室柔光人像)

你可以在gradio_demo.py中找到更多预设提示词。

光照方向控制技巧

通过调整"Lighting Preference"参数,你可以精确控制光源方向:

  • Left:左侧光源
  • Right:右侧光源
  • Top:顶部光源
  • Bottom:底部光源

不同光照方向下的图像效果对比,展现IC-Light精准的光照控制能力

🛠️ 技术原理:IC-Light如何实现精准光照控制

IC-Light的核心优势在于其"Imposing Consistent Light"技术。在HDR空间中,所有光传输都是独立的,因此不同光源的外观混合等效于混合光源的外观。IC-Light在训练时通过在 latent 空间中使用MLP来施加这种一致性,使模型能够产生高度一致的重新打光效果。

这种技术使得IC-Light生成的不同光照效果甚至可以合并为法线贴图,尽管模型本身是基于潜在扩散模型训练的,并未使用任何法线贴图数据。

📝 模型说明与选择建议

IC-Light提供多种模型选择,满足不同场景需求:

  • iclight_sd15_fc.safetensors:默认光照模型,基于文本和前景条件,可使用初始潜变量影响光照效果
  • iclight_sd15_fcon.safetensors:与fc模型类似,但使用偏移噪声训练
  • iclight_sd15_fbc.safetensors:基于文本、前景和背景条件的光照模型

所有模型文件都保存在models/目录下,首次运行时会自动下载。

📄 开源许可与商业使用

IC-Light采用开源许可,但需要注意的是,原始的BRIA RMBG 1.4背景移除模型仅供非商业使用。如果您需要将IC-Light用于商业项目,建议替换为其他背景替换工具如BiRefNet。

🎯 应用场景与创意灵感

IC-Light的应用范围广泛,包括但不限于:

  • 摄影后期处理:无需专业设备即可模拟各种光线条件
  • 电商产品展示:为商品图片创建最佳展示光线
  • 社交媒体内容创作:快速制作具有专业光影效果的图片
  • 设计原型:为设计作品快速尝试不同光照方案

无论你是专业摄影师、设计师,还是普通用户,IC-Light都能帮助你轻松实现创意光影效果,让每一张图片都光彩夺目!

现在就尝试IC-Light,开启你的光影创作之旅吧!

【免费下载链接】IC-LightMore relighting!项目地址: https://gitcode.com/GitHub_Trending/ic/IC-Light

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/467718/

相关文章:

  • LlamaIndex终极指南:零基础快速掌握AI数据框架开发
  • 7分钟上手FastAPI-MCP:零代码实现AI模型与文件传输功能的无缝对接
  • Windows部署OpenClaw指南
  • Easy Email:重新定义拖拽式邮件编辑器和邮件模板生成的终极方案
  • 5步掌握Spring AI集成Google Gemini 2.5模型的技术实践
  • Emotion2Vec+ Large在线会议助手:发言人情绪实时提示功能
  • 如何快速掌握cmark:高效CommonMark解析器的完整指南
  • 2026年优质血液净化设备推荐——健帆生物DX-10与Future F20详解 - 品牌2026
  • apidoc 插件系统终极指南:从设计原理到实战开发
  • 终极PCSX2模拟器优化指南:从卡顿到丝滑的300%性能提升秘籍
  • 阿里云代理商:阿里云 OpenClaw + 飞书集成实战指南 高频问题全解答
  • 一站式出海营销服务商哪家好?涵盖Facebook、TikTok、INS、Google与LinkedIn等多平台营销推荐(2026年3月更新) - 品牌2026
  • 如何让沉默的文档开口说话?5大智能解析技巧揭秘
  • 终极DeepSeek-LLM训练监控指南:从异常检测到性能优化的完整路径
  • GPT-OSS自动化部署脚本分享:CI/CD集成实战案例
  • FSMN-VAD镜像使用指南:免配置一键部署,支持麦克风实时检测
  • 2024终极LLM工程师手册:从零构建生产级大型语言模型应用
  • Z-Image-Turbo支持哪些硬件?消费级显卡兼容性评测
  • Flutter 三方库 cosee_lints 的鸿蒙化适配指南 - 让代码审计回归“工业级严苛”,打造鸿蒙应用专家级的 Core 研发质量审计中台
  • Open-AutoGLM高效操控秘诀:动作序列优化实战教程
  • 如何解决网站反广告拦截问题:Anti-Adblock Killer完整使用指南
  • 如何用4个核心组件构建企业级Vue.js AR应用:打造60fps流畅体验的完整指南
  • 实时手机检测-通用完整指南:从requirements安装到service日志排查
  • java+vue+SpringBoot药店管理系统(程序+数据库+报告+部署教程+答辩指导)
  • 如何用Apache ECharts实现教育数据的深度洞察:5步方法论与实战指南
  • Python 面向对象之魔术方法详细教程
  • Flutter 三方库 simple_model 的鸿蒙化适配指南 - 让数据建模回归“极致纯粹”,打造鸿蒙应用专家级的 POJO 持久化与映射中台
  • 【经验分享】写给初学者的网络安全学习路线图谱
  • BootstrapBlazor导航组件终极指南:3个核心组件快速构建企业级应用
  • Qwen3-8B本地运行:Mac M系列芯片部署教程